43 providers in Neuro-ophthalmology, Neurophysiology, Podiatric Surgery (Foot And Ankle Surgery), Preventive Medicine

43 providers in Neuro-ophthalmology, Neurophysiology, Podiatric Surgery (Foot And Ankle Surgery), Preventive Medicine